Business licences & permits — Makkovik, Newfoundland and Labrador
Do I need a business licence or permit? What does it cost?
In the Inuit community government of Makkovik, Newfoundland and Labrador, licence required: True; who must license: Persons selling food from a vending vehicle within Town limits, excluding exempt groups like newspapers, youth fundraisers, charities.; fee: Daily Rate $ 10.00, Seasonal Rate $ 50.00, Annual Rate $ 150.00; renewal: valid for a period of two years from the date it is approved. Source: Makkovik Inuit Community Government Vendor Regulations, verified 2026-06-05.

Regulates vendors and peddlers operating within Makkovik Inuit Community Government lands; requires a vendor permit; covers mobile food vending, goods sales, and permit conditions. Cited as May 1 2013 on the bylaws index page.
